Yes get rid of the paint and have a dry smooth surface for the hose to seal to. A similar situation came up on a tour where a friend with a 54 pick-up actually had the hose pop off the gooseneck and no matter how tight the clamp the problem persisted until the paint was removed both from the gooseneck and the hose inner surface.
